Round 26 brings finals implications in almost every game, but results are as tricky as ever to tip, with plenty of teams producing inconsistent form lines and injuries playing their part towards the end of the season.
From the Penrith Panthers resting their entire side to the three-way race for the eighth spot, Round 26 has a multitude of storylines to follow.
There will be an abundance of try-scorers, with some mismatches evident and several returning players set to headline the action.
